Output 0742999e5ccf96f31c1a7142687cb96c04aab91d37ebe274998d278ac7920925:21

value
313691
script pubkey
OP_0 OP_PUSHBYTES_20 d44ba755694e99ff2b21b22e7ebc047226865168
address
bc1q6396w4tff6vl72epkgh8a0qywgngv5tg3avr3n
transaction
0742999e5ccf96f31c1a7142687cb96c04aab91d37ebe274998d278ac7920925
spent
true